Summary:In this paper, we derive closed-form solutions for transient structural responses of an undamped single degree of freedom structural system subjected to an impact acceleration pulse of a half-sine waveform. The application of the response spectra to a specific printed circuit board is demonstrated. An insight is also provided to analyzing transient structural responses of a multiple degrees of freedom structural system led by the same type of impact acceleration pulses through modal superposition.
